Throughout his independent scientific career spanning three decades, Franck Polleux has focused on the identification of the cellular and molecular mechanisms underlying neuronal development in the mammalian brain. More recently, his lab started studying the genetic basis of human brain evolution by focusing on the role of human-specific gene duplications as genetic modifiers of synaptic connectivity, circuit function and their impact on cognition. His most recent work demonstrates that human-specific genes such as SRGAP2B/C not only represent human-specific modifiers of brain development but also represent unique human-specific disease modifiers in the context of neurodevelopmental disorders such as autism spectrum disorders.
For his numerous scientific contributions, Polleux was awarded several prestigious awards such as the Albert L. Lehninger Research Prize for postdoctoral research, the 2005 NARSAD Young Investigator Award, the 2015 Foundation Roger De Spoelberch Prize and the 2021 R35 Research Program Award, a career award from the NIH-National Institute of Neurological Disorders and Stroke (NINDS).
